In view of the fact that my mother and I are good friends and know something about their personalities and abilities, I finally made an academic plan with them: specialize in my favorite major, and then minor in psychology, focusing on the application of psychology. For example, if you want to study finance, management and education in the future, you can minor in psychology and focus on applied psychology such as financial psychology, management psychology, educational psychology and biological psychology.

Even if universities don't offer such courses, there are many learning channels if they want to learn now. For example, massively open online courses offer many psychology courses. Almost all key universities have online psychology courses.
